Electrical Discharge Machining (EDM) is a method of using sparks to machine metal. EDM isn’t a new technology, in fact commercial machines have been around since the 1960’s.

Jauch & Schmider CNC rotary tables from Koma Precision add one, two, or three axes to EDM machines. They are fully submergible and come in standard and application-specific, multi-axis configurations.
